Have to say, this would really ruin the game for a lot of people. Probably the biggest issue here is connectivity. I don't want to lose any hard earned items because someone calls me or the network starts getting laggy.

Also, this could potentially turn off new players to the game very quickly. Let's say you're level 20 and after saving gold for twenty levels you buy a relatively expensive shield. And then on your quest to decapitate Hagvar you die for whatever reason (let's be honest here, new players die quite a bit in unfamiliar scenarios) and lose some gear. Then, frustrated, you try again and die again and lose more gear. Now, not only are you out of money, but you don't even have decent equipment with which to make money.

There's a very popular mmo that has this system in place and its just disgusting. You can spend countless hours earning gold to buy incredibly expensive items and then lose it all in a matter of a few seconds. One of the things that attracts me to Celtic Heroes is that it isn't just a big grind-fest to get gold and buy gear. Also, if this system were implemented it would give an enormous advantage to players that could just lunk out $20-$40 each time they lost something valuable.

On a side note, when dueling/pvp is implemented I would like the ability to wager valuable items or gold, but I would rather not lose items that aren't up for wager. Also, if you automatically lose items on death in pvp then you're going to see this community overrun by scammers, luring, and general deceit.

I would much rather play a game that's just simply fun to play with other people than play a game that forces you to waste enormous amounts of time grinding to get back your lost gear.

As an alternative, why not make a cool-down time on resurrections (not the platinum purchased ones) or just leave it alone altogether. This is Celtic Heroes, a game on your iPhone, this isn't RS...

I personally reject the idea of losing or damaging items.
Death happens too often and would happen all the more often if your character got significantly weaker each time it happened.

I also hate the idea of PvP, but probably only because i am a druid and therefore a tasty chew toy for anyone that can deal more than 20 damage per tick.

But, if you were going to put a death penalty in, i would recommend making it something that the player could earn back easily
experience points for example

then so long as (fixed xp cost of dying)< (Xp gained from killing a monster) x (number of monsters a non AFK player can kill before dying)
no one should really kick off about it, and if they do then they can just be told to get better at playing the game.

Top level players would probably find that the xp being awarded now is insufficient to prevent losing xp and levels, but as they leveled down they would start to earn more xp from the same monsters.

Though i am not sure what effect losing levels would have on stats and skills, maybe repeatedly dying would become the poor mans book of rebirth/alteration
and you would have to level back up the hard way.
